Real-Time Stats: The Heartbeat of the Game

Real-time stats are the lifeblood of any basketball game, providing instant insights into player performances, team strategies, and overall game flow. For the Lakers vs Timberwolves game, keeping an eye on these numbers can reveal critical information that goes beyond the surface. Key stats to watch include points per game, field goal percentages, three-point percentages, rebounds, assists, steals, and blocks. Each of these metrics tells a story about which players are dominating, which team is executing their game plan effectively, and where the critical battles are being won or lost.

For example, if LeBron James is having a night where he's racking up assists, it signals that the Lakers' offense is flowing smoothly and that his teammates are capitalizing on his playmaking abilities. On the other hand, if Anthony Edwards is consistently driving to the basket and scoring, it indicates that the Timberwolves are exploiting mismatches and attacking the paint with aggression. These real-time observations allow you to anticipate potential adjustments in strategy and appreciate the nuances of the game.

Moreover, advanced stats such as player efficiency rating (PER), true shooting percentage (TS%), and win shares can offer even deeper insights. PER, for instance, provides a single number that encapsulates a player's overall contribution, while TS% accounts for the efficiency of all types of shots. Win shares estimate the number of wins a player contributes to their team. By tracking these metrics, you gain a more comprehensive understanding of which players are truly making a difference and how their performance impacts the team's chances of winning.

In addition to individual stats, team-level metrics are equally crucial. Pace, offensive rating, defensive rating, and net rating provide a snapshot of how the Lakers and Timberwolves are performing collectively. A high offensive rating suggests that a team is scoring efficiently, while a low defensive rating indicates strong defensive performance. The pace of the game reflects how quickly a team is playing, and the net rating (the difference between offensive and defensive ratings) offers an overall assessment of a team's effectiveness. Monitoring these stats in real-time allows you to see which team is controlling the tempo, executing their game plan, and ultimately, gaining the upper hand.

Impact of Live Stats on In-Game Strategies

Live stats play a pivotal role in shaping in-game strategies for both the Lakers and the Timberwolves. Coaches and players constantly analyze these real-time metrics to make informed decisions and adjustments. For example, if the Lakers are struggling to contain Anthony Edwards's drives to the basket, they might adjust their defensive scheme to provide more help in the paint or switch defenders to find a better matchup. Similarly, if the Timberwolves are having trouble scoring against Anthony Davis's interior defense, they might try to spread the floor and create more outside shooting opportunities.

Coaches use live stats to identify mismatches and exploit weaknesses in the opponent's defense. If LeBron James is consistently drawing fouls on a particular defender, the Lakers might continue to target that matchup to put the defender in foul trouble. On the other hand, if Karl-Anthony Towns is struggling to score against a specific defender, the Timberwolves might try to create more opportunities for him in different areas of the court or adjust their offensive sets to get him easier looks. These strategic adjustments are often driven by real-time data and can significantly impact the outcome of the game.

Furthermore, live stats influence timeout decisions and player rotations. If a team is on a scoring run, the opposing coach might call a timeout to disrupt their momentum and regroup. Coaches also use stats to identify which players are performing well and which ones are struggling. For instance, if a bench player is providing a spark on offense or defense, the coach might give them more playing time. Conversely, if a starter is having a rough night, the coach might consider substituting them with a player who can provide a different dynamic. These decisions are based on real-time performance data and are crucial for maximizing the team's chances of success.
